Von CFormView-Dialog auf Doc zugreifen



  • Hallo ich hab mein Fenster geteilt und oben wird ein CFormView-Dialog angezeigt. Aus diesem Dialog möchte ich auf die Doc zugreifen. Aber ich habe ja keinen Zeiger auf die Doc.

    Normalerweise würde ich den Dialog folgendermaßen aufbauen aber das geht ja jetzt schlecht:

    CDialog2 var;
    var.DocZeiger = this->GetDocument();



  • Hallo,

    natürlich hast du Zugriff auf das Dokument aus der View (so ist ja die MFC konzipiert), denn CFormView hat als Basisklasse unter anderem CView, und welche Methode bietet CView? :

    MSDN schrieb:

    CView::GetDocument

    CDocument* GetDocument( ) const;

    😉

    MfG


Anmelden zum Antworten